Kurz Adds to NAG Record Haul

EAST MEADOW, New York, April 2. COMPETING at the Eastern Zone All-Star Championships at the Nassau County Aquatic Center, Tanner Kurz (Delaware Swim Team) established a pair of 11-12 NAG records. Kurz took down standards in the 100 individual medley and 200 breaststroke with respective times of 55.56 and 2:13.52. His swim in the 100 I.M. broke his own record from early March.

A few weeks removed from setting an NAG mark in the 400 I.M., Kurz also set a quartet of Eastern Zone records. The 12-year-old clocked 2:00.19 in the 200 I.M., 1:00.94 in the 100 breaststroke, 49.98 in the 100 freestyle and 54.95 in the 100 butterfly.
